apexGbeConfIfRedundAutoSwitchBackEnable

Module: APEX-MIB

OID (symbolic): APEX-MIB::apexGbeConfIfRedundAutoSwitchBackEnable

OID (numeric): 1.3.6.1.4.1.1166.1.31.7.1.7.1.1

Node type: OBJECT-TYPE

Type: EnableDisableTYPE

Access: read-write

Description: Enables the ability for the secondary interface to switch back when link is re-detected on the primary interface. Auto switch back to the primary interface will not occur if the user forced a failover to the secondary. Auto switch back only occurs after a non-forced failover.

Once written, the change to this parameter will take immediate effect. However, in order for the change to persist through subsequent reboots or power cycles, the change must be saved via apexSaveConfig.

@Config(config=yes, reboot=no) @Save(apexSaveConfig, value=2) @File(gige_red.ini, type='ini')

What is apexGbeConfIfRedundAutoSwitchBackEnable?

Enables automatic restoration of traffic to the primary GbE interface after it recovers from a link failure, provided the original failover was not operator-initiated. When disabled, the device remains on the secondary interface even after the primary link returns.

Examples

Walk all instances (SNMPv2c):

snmpwalk -v2c -c public <target> 1.3.6.1.4.1.1166.1.31.7.1.7.1.1
snmpwalk -v2c -c public <target> APEX-MIB::apexGbeConfIfRedundAutoSwitchBackEnable

Get a specific instance (index 1):

snmpget -v2c -c public <target> 1.3.6.1.4.1.1166.1.31.7.1.7.1.1.1
snmpget -v2c -c public <target> APEX-MIB::apexGbeConfIfRedundAutoSwitchBackEnable.1

Set instance 1 (SNMPv2c):

snmpset -v2c -c private <target> 1.3.6.1.4.1.1166.1.31.7.1.7.1.1.1 s <value>

SNMPv3 example:

snmpget -v3 -l authPriv -u snmpv3-user -a SHA -A "AuthPassword1" -x AES -X "PrivPassword1" <target> apexGbeConfIfRedundAutoSwitchBackEnable.1
